Frequently Asked Questions

Which ASTM standards govern UniSafe medical nitrile and latex exam gloves?

Our medical examination gloves are engineered and batch-tested to strictly meet the following national medical specifications:

  • ASTM D6319: Standard Specification for Nitrile Examination Gloves for Medical Application.
  • ASTM D3578: Standard Specification for Rubber Examination Gloves (Latex).
  • ASTM D5151: Standard Test Method for Detection of Holes in Medical Gloves via the 1,000 mL water-leak protocol.

How do UniSafe exam gloves help facilities comply with OSHA regulations?

Under the OSHA Bloodborne Pathogens Standard (29 CFR 1910.1030), healthcare employers are legally required to provide app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) to employees at risk of occupational exposure to blood or other potentially infectious materials (OPIM). UniSafe's FDA 510(k) cleared exam gloves provide the certified, impermeable fluid barrier mandatory to protect clinical staff and maintain regulatory workplace compliance.

What does the AQL rating mean for hospital-grade gloves?

AQL stands for Acceptable Quality Level, which measures the pinhole defect rate within a manufacturing batch using the ASTM D5151 water-leak test. To earn FDA clearance for medical and clinical examinations, a glove batch must meet an AQL threshold of 2.5 or lower (meaning less than 2.5% of the batch can fail). UniSafe premium hospital gloves are manufactured to strict tolerances, ensuring highly reliable barrier safety that fully aligns with these medical mandates.

Why are powder-free gloves standard across modern hospital networks?

Powder-free gloves are the absolute standard in healthcare because the cornstarch powder used in older glove models can bind to latex proteins and become airborne, triggering severe respiratory allergies or asthma attacks in patients and staff. Furthermore, glove powder can contaminate clinical tools, interfere with wound healing inside medical environments, and contribute to post-operative complications.
